Solution Overview
Problem
Current quality control methods for plastic container products are time-consuming and costly due to manual testing by trained personnel, which negatively impacts the cost-effectiveness of production and can lead to production of defective products.
Innovation Solution
An automated quality control method where predetermined properties of container products are determined and compared to target values at inspection stations, eliminating the need for manual testing and allowing for real-time optimization of the manufacturing process.

A method establishes the presence of specified characteristics of a container product (9, 11), more particularly of a plastic material. The value of at least one specified characteristic is automatically recorded and compared with the reference value for that characteristic in at least one testing station (1-7) of a testing device.
